A MEISSEN GROUP OF COLUMBINE AND PANTALOON modelled by J.J. Kändler, she seated with her mask under her right arm in a white tricorn hat and black cap, red-lined turquoise cape, purple bodice with gilt scrolls, turquoise sash and skirt with indianische Blumen and stroking Pantaloon's beard, he in grey-lined yellow cloak, blue waistcoat incised with scrolls, black breeches and red slippers striding towards Columbine on a mound base applied with flowers (slight restoration to her right cuff and foot, minor chips to flowers and leaves), faint blue crossed swords mark, circa 1740
